What This Means (2025 FDD)

According to Bhc's 2025 Franchise Disclosure Document, as a Master Franchisee, you are obligated to comply with all terms and conditions of each Franchise Agreement, including the operating requirements detailed within. This means ensuring that all subfranchisees also adhere to these operating requirements. These requirements cover various aspects of the business, including the sale of authorized products, adherence to operational procedures, and maintenance of adequate supplies.

Bhc requires that a General Manager, or the Master Franchisee themselves, actively manage the Franchised Business during normal business hours. This individual must dedicate their entire time to the business and ensure timely and professional service to customers. Master Franchisees must ensure that only approved BHC products and beverages are sold, sourced from designated vendors and suppliers. The operation of the franchised business must strictly adhere to the procedures outlined in the Operations Manual, with online ordering exclusively through Bhc's official website.

To maintain the integrity and goodwill of the Bhc system, Master Franchisees must ensure compliance with the methodologies prescribed for providing BHC Products to customers. This includes using standard signs and formats and complying with established standards, operating procedures, and rules regarding ingredients, brand names, preparation, and presentation. Master Franchisees are also responsible for purchasing and ensuring subfranchisees purchase equipment and inventory to meet consumer demand and ancillary products as specified by Bhc.

Master Franchisees must purchase all products, including those bearing Bhc's marks, exclusively from Bhc or its designated suppliers. Before opening a BHC Restaurant, Master Franchisees and subfranchisees must purchase an opening inventory of merchandise and supplies, including proprietary products, from Bhc and its affiliates. Bhc will provide a list of approved manufacturers, suppliers, and distributors, as well as approved inventory products, fixtures, furniture, equipment, signs, stationery, supplies, and other necessary items.
